Overview

Help kids become more confident readers with skill-building activities for grades 1-3 Reading skills don't come easily to every child-which just means they could use a little extra support! This book of reading games for struggling readers makes it easy for kids to get the practice they need and have some fun along the way. The lessons feature simple games and adorable illustrations designed to keep kids motivated and curious as they learn to read at their own pace. Essential skills-Target the four key elements of reading fluency with activities that focus on phonics, sight words, sentence structure, and reading comprehension. 101 ways to play-Kids will discover word searches, coloring pages, mazes, and more as they explore more than 100 interactive reading exercises. Learn and grow-Watch kids improve over time with reading games that get more challenging as the book progresses. Give kids the tools to succeed in school and beyond with the Reading Games Workbook for Struggling Readers.

Author Information

CATHY HENRY, MS, has been a teacher for nearly 14 years. She earned her elementary education degree from Purdue University, followed by a master's degree in special education from Indiana University-Purdue University Indianapolis. She has two websites where she creates and shares resources for teachers- thecurriculumcorner.com and freewordwork.com.
